Mark HallMark Hall was born in 1956 to Ray & Gloria Hall and became the first of the 2nd Generation of Hall Bros. to burn-up the quarter mile!
As a child Mark loved shadowing his Dad Ray in the garage and at the track as he worked on cars and pursued the dream of racing. His earliest foray into racing was motocross which he did well into his early twenties. By his teenage years he was drag racing at the track along side his Dad and brothers. In the early 80's Mark briefly raced sprint cars and got married and began a family. The first drag car he owned was built mostly by his own hands and he raced this car into the 90's when he purchased the car he owns now, 23T Altered, from Sutherland/Leamer and upgraded and modified it. Mark met his wife Lisa at work (McClellan AFB) back in 1989, which is a sweet coincedence, as his parents also met there, back in the 1950's. Mark runs a blown, fuel injected Big Block Chevy Engine and currently races in the 7.60 NE-1(Nostalgia Eliminator) Class. |
